Description

Corkscrew curls are the focus of Anna Camp's hairstyle and give it bounce and movement. The side part and tumbling curls give this 'do a slightly windblown look and with the body and volume from the curls, this 'do is great to frame a long or angular face. Product is needed for hold and shine and regular trims will help prevent split ends. Anna's golden blonde color is another fabulous feature of this 'do and will need regular root touch ups to maintain its look.

Styling Steps


1. Apply Mousse

step 1

Apply styling mousse to damp hair, using your palm as a measuring guide, and evenly distribute it along the hair shaft. Styling mousse will add hold and can help achieve better results.


2. Part to the Right

step 2

Using the corner of your comb and standing in front of a mirror find the middle of your right eye and then drag the comb straight up slowly until you reach your hairline and then continue back in a straight manner to achieve an even right part. A side part is great for longer face shapes because it creates the illusion of width.


3. Flip Head and Use a Diffuser and Fingers

step 3

Tip your head upside down and move the diffuser up to the ends, motioning the diffuser to the scalp in circular movements. Make sure the blow-dryer speed is on low and try not to completely dry the hair off. Leaving a little bit of moisture will allow the hair to dry naturally.


4. Apply Hot Rollers Vertically to the Side

step 4

Take a section of hair no wider than the diameter of the hot roller and comb it through to ensure there are no knots. Place the roller at the ends of the section of hair, being sure to smooth the ends under, and then twist the roller vertically, making sure to roll it backwards, along the hair shaft to the roots and secure it with a pin or clip. Keep the rollers in your hair until they cool.


5. Apply Hot Rollers Through the Back

step 5

Take the entire back section of your hair, and then starting from the crown, take a smaller section of hair no wider than the diameter of the hot roller and comb it through to ensure there are no knots. Place the roller at the ends of the section of hair, being sure to smooth the ends under, and then twist the roller down the hair shaft until it meets your head and then secure it in place with a pin or clip. Repeat this step until you have reached the nape of your neck and the entire back section of your hair is completed. Keep the rollers in your hair until they cool.


6. Scrunch Moulding Cream Through Hair with Fingers

step 6

Apply moulding cream to your fingertips and then tilt your head forward and scrunch your hair.


7. Piece the Ends Using Moulding Cream

step 7

Apply a small amount of moulding cream to your fingertips and then lightly piece and pinch the ends of your hair.


8. Apply Hairspray

step 8

To finish, apply a minimal amount of hairspray from an arms length distance to the top, sides and back. Take care not to use too much or you will end up with a white, flaky residue which looks like dandruff.
